Recently, the results of the 2026 Metallurgical Science and Technology Awards were announced. The project “Development and Application of Key Technologies for High-Strength, Tough, Extra-Thick Steel Plates for Marine Equipment,” jointly submitted by Wugang Company and Northeastern University, was awarded the Grand Prize, marking a major breakthrough for China in the field of critical materials for marine engineering. After ten years of intensive research and sustained efforts, the project has successfully overcome the challenges in producing high-strength, tough, extra-thick steel plates—materials essential for building such national strategic assets as ultra-large deepwater drilling platforms, massive wind‑farm installation vessels, and 10,000‑meter‑class submersibles.
